What Is the Leapin’ Fortnite Dance?

Leapin’ is a Rare traversal emote in Fortnite Battle Royale. Traversal emotes let your character move around the map while dancing, which is why clips of Leapin’ are so popular in highlights and memes. The move features a continuous, bouncy jump pattern synced to a looping beat, making it ideal for:

  • Short meme videos and reaction clips
  • TikTok and YouTube Shorts edits
  • Channel intros or stream stingers
  • Community content for Fortnite‑focused creators and brands
